This week the ladies are chatting with Ruth Crane - A thriving Triple Negative Breast Cancer survivor and founder of Ears To You. Ruth shares with Randalynn and Vicki about her her cancer diagnosis and how she started her non-profit. Not only is she a cancer advocate, a blessing to the cancer community, but also a caring, thoughtful Mom.  
Ears To You began donating earrings in June 2008 and has helped thousands of cancer patients feel joyful and hopeful. They now host a yearly Gala raising funds for to continue supporting cancer patients and honoring amazing survivors. 
Ears To You was developed out of the sense to help other people undergoing cancer treatments enjoy that same feeling of normalcy and hope as they too dealt with their loss of hair, or the stress of cancer treatments.  While in the hospital for a possible infection while undergoing chemotherapy, the idea of Ears To You came to Ruth.  She felt instantly better with her things from home – things that made her feel like herself – and thought maybe other cancer patients would feel better with these items too.  Ruth feels like the idea was divinely inspired since she desired to do something to help other cancer patients that was easy and affordable.
